Effect of Integration of Linseed and Vitamin E in Charolaise × Podolica Bulls’ Diet on Fatty Acids Profile, Beef Color and Lipid Stability
Dietary supplementation with oilseeds improves the fatty acid profiles of meat, but results are often inconsistent.
